计算10+9+8+7+6+5+4+3+2+1
时间: 2023-09-14 21:08:06 浏览: 224
这是一个简单的倒序计数问题,可以通过手算或者编程来求解。手算的话,可以逐步减去每个数字,得到答案为:
10 - 1 = 9
9 - 1 = 8
8 - 1 = 7
7 - 1 = 6
6 - 1 = 5
5 - 1 = 4
4 - 1 = 3
3 - 1 = 2
2 - 1 = 1
因此,10 9 8 7 6 5 4 3 2 1 的计算结果为:9 8 7 6 5 4 3 2 1。
如果用编程来求解,可以使用循环语句,从10开始倒序循环到1,每次输出当前循环变量的值即可。以下是一个Python语言的示例代码:
for i in range(10, 0, -1):
print(i)
输出结果为:
10
9
8
7
6
5
4
3
2
1
相关问题
编写程序计算10+9+8+7+6+4+5+3+2+1
这里提供两种方式:
方式一:使用循环遍历列表并累加
```python
num_list = [10, 9, 8, 7, 6, 4, 5, 3, 2, 1]
result = 0
for num in num_list:
result += num
print(result)
```
输出结果为:55
方式二:使用内置函数sum计算列表元素和
```python
num_list = [10, 9, 8, 7, 6, 4, 5, 3, 2, 1]
result = sum(num_list)
print(result)
```
输出结果为:55
用python编写程序计算10+9+8+7+6+4+5+3+2+1
可以使用Python中的列表和循环来实现:
```python
nums = [10, 9, 8, 7, 6, 4, 5, 3, 2, 1]
result = 1
for num in nums:
result *= num
print(result)
```
输出结果为:3628800
相关推荐
![pptx](https://img-home.csdnimg.cn/images/20210720083543.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)